Police: Trunk Sale; Barking Dog

Excerpts from the Reading Police Department log.

Monday, Nov. 30

At 6:30 a.m., there was a report of an outdoor odor of natural gas on Summer Avenue.

At 7:16 a.m., State Police called for assistance with an accident involving a small bus and a car on Salem Street.

At 7:38 a.m., there was a report of a possible motor vehicle accident on Salem Street.

At 8:40 a.m., the DPW was notified about icy road conditions on Salem Street.

At 9:38 a.m., a car hit a deer on Main Street.

At 10:13 a.m., there was a report of an ex-employee making threats at a bank on Main Street.

At 11:01 a.m., the municipal parking lot sign on Pleasant Street was broken and blowing in the wind.

At 11:43 a.m., police received a text tip about someone selling clothes out of the trunk of a car behind a business on Haven Street.

At 10:44 p.m., there was a complaint about a dog that had been barking for 40 minutes on Willow Street.
